'Bretagne' French dreadnought of 25,000 Tons, c1915-1940. Built at Brest between 1912 and 1915, the Bretagne served in the Mediterranean in both world wars. She was one of the ships sunk by the British at Mers-el-Kebir in 1940 to stop the French fleet falling into the hands of the Germans. From the Bernard Crochet Archive.
